01 性能測試工具

\color{deepskyblue}{\mathtt{\small{PS:}\small{該內(nèi)容為學習筆記,如有錯誤敬請指正。}}}

\mathtt{1.\;LoadRunner}

LoadRunner 是一款\color{red}{工業(yè)級}的性能測試工具,能夠模擬上萬用戶實施測試,并可在測試時實時監(jiān)控服務器硬件各種數(shù)據(jù)。

最初由 Mercury 公司采用 C 語言編寫的,現(xiàn)被 HP 公司收購。

LoadRunner 可支持多種協(xié)議:Web(HTTP / HTML)、Windows Sockets、FTP、ODBC、MS SQL Server等。

\mathbf{\color{#A0206C}{優(yōu)點:}}

  • 支持多用戶(支持的數(shù)量單位:萬)

  • 支持 IP 欺騙(LoadRunner 給服務器發(fā)送請求時,每發(fā)一次 IP 就會變一次)

  • 具有詳細的分析報表

\mathbf{\color{#A0206C}{缺點:}}

  • 收費 \color{grey}{\small{:)收費怎么不算缺點呢}}

  • 體積龐大(單位GB)

  • 無法定制功能

\mathtt{2.\; JMeter}

JMeter 是 Apache 組織開發(fā)的基于 Java 的\color{red}{開源}軟件,其最初被設計用于 Web 應用測試,后來擴展到了其他測試領域,例如靜態(tài)文件、Java 程序、Shell 腳本、Mail 等。

\mathbf{\color{#A0206C}{優(yōu)點:}}

  • 免費

  • 開源

  • 小巧

  • 具有豐富的學習資料及擴展組件

  • 應用廣泛

  • 易上手

\mathbf{\color{#A0206C}{缺點:}}

  • 不支持IP欺騙(JMeter 給服務器發(fā)送多個請求時,IP 不會變化)

  • 分析和報表能力相對于 LoadRunner 欠缺

?著作權歸作者所有,轉(zhuǎn)載或內(nèi)容合作請聯(lián)系作者
【社區(qū)內(nèi)容提示】社區(qū)部分內(nèi)容疑似由AI輔助生成,瀏覽時請結(jié)合常識與多方信息審慎甄別。
平臺聲明:文章內(nèi)容(如有圖片或視頻亦包括在內(nèi))由作者上傳并發(fā)布,文章內(nèi)容僅代表作者本人觀點,簡書系信息發(fā)布平臺,僅提供信息存儲服務。

相關閱讀更多精彩內(nèi)容

友情鏈接更多精彩內(nèi)容